CBSE · Class 12 · Physics · Alternating CurrentIn a purely inductive AC circuit, the phase difference between current and voltage is:

Step-by-Step Solution

In an AC circuit containing only an inductor, alternating voltage leads the current by a phase angle of $90^\circ$ or $\pi/2$ radians.
